TokenIM 2.0 源码介绍

TokenIM 2.0 是一款开源的即时通讯工具,主要用于满足用户在多种场景下的沟通需求。TokenIM 不仅具备高效的消息传递功能,它的安全性和可扩展性也是其受到开发者广泛欢迎的原因。本文将详细介绍 TokenIM 2.0 的源码下载、安装、配置及使用在内的一系列内容,帮助开发者更好地理解和利用这一工具。

TokenIM 2.0 源码下载

下载 TokenIM 2.0 源码非常简单,开发者只需前往其官方GitHub页面或官方网站,找到最新版本的源码发布链接,点击下载即可。在这里,TokenIM 提供了不同平台的适配版本,包括 Windows、macOS和 Linux 等。源码包通常以 zip 或 tar.gz 形式提供,用户只需解压缩,无需额外安装其他软件。

安装与配置

下载完成后,在进行安装之前,用户需要先检查自己的开发环境。TokenIM 2.0 对系统的要求相对较低,但至少需要安装 Java 环境和相应的数据库(例如 MySQL 或 MongoDB)。在安装过程中,用户需要确保网络连接正常,并根据具体的操作系统选择合适的安装图标或命令。

安装完成之后,用户需要对 TokenIM 进行相应的配置。通常来说,配置文件位于项目的根目录下,通常名为 config.properties。用户需根据自己的实际环境调整数据库连接设置、服务器配置和其它相关参数。建议在每次修改配置后重启服务以确保修改生效。

使用指南

完成安装及配置后,用户可以通过终端或命令行工具启动 TokenIM 服务器,接着在客户端进行连接。用户可以在客户端注册新的账号,或使用已有的用户ID登陆。一旦成功登陆,用户就可以开始发送、接收信息、创建群组等一系列操作。

TokenIM 提供的界面友好、操作直观,用户可以根据需要自定义聊天窗口的皮肤和布局。为了确保数据安全,TokenIM 在传输过程中采用了加密技术,用户可以放心使用。

常见问题解答

1. TokenIM 2.0 的优势是什么?

TokenIM 2.0 相较于之前版本在多个方面进行了,提供了一系列更强大的功能。首先,增强的数据安全性确保用户的聊天记录和个人信息不会泄露。此外,TokenIM 2.0 还支持高并发访问,可以同时容纳更多用户,无论是个人用户还是企业使用都毫无压力。通过代码,运行速度得到了显著提升,用户在使用时可以体验到更流畅的操作。

对于开发者而言,TokenIM 2.0 提供了更易于扩展的架构,允许用户根据自己的需求修改源代码。此外,社区支持也相对丰富,用户可以在社区中交流使用经验,获取技术支持和资源。

2. 如何为 TokenIM 添加额外的功能?

对于希望为 TokenIM 添加额外功能的用户,可以直接在源码中进行修改。作为一种开源软件,TokenIM 的设计架构使得扩展和修改变得更加灵活。用户需要了解 Java 语言及其开发工具,才能有效进行后续的开发工作。

首先,用户应该查看 TokenIM 的开发文档,了解代码的整体结构和各个模块的功能。通过定位需要修改的文件和方法,用户可以进行相应的扩展和功能整合。如果用户希望集成新的 API,可以在项目中寻找合适的位置插入代码调用的逻辑。这一过程需要开发人员具备一定的编程基础和逻辑思维能力。

3. TokenIM 2.0 是否支持移动端使用?

TokenIM 2.0 本身是以桌面端为主,但通过相应的技术手段,可以实现移动端的使用。开发者可以借助相关库,创建移动端的客户端,从而实现与服务器的连接。也可以考虑使用网页应用的形式,通过浏览器访问并操作 TokenIM 的功能。

对于企业来说,开发移动端应用也能增加用户的使用频率,提升用户体验。在设计移动端时,用户需要考虑不同屏幕尺寸、分辨率的适配问题,并确保操作流畅、界面美观。

4. TokenIM 的安全性如何保障?

安全性是即时通讯工具的核心考量之一。TokenIM 2.0 在设计之初就极其重视数据的安全传输及存储。它采用了先进的加密技术确保数据在传输过程中的安全性,避免了用户信息在网络中被截获的风险。

另外,在用户数据的存储上,TokenIM 提供了多层安全防护机制。用户数据库和聊天记录都被进行了加密处理,即使数据库遭到攻击,也难以被不法分子轻易破解。用户可在设置中开启双重验证等功能,以进一步提升账户的安全性。

随着网络环境的越来越复杂,安全问题变得日益重要。TokenIM 也在不断进行版本升级,紧跟行业标准,定期进行安全漏洞的检测和修补,从而确保用户能够安全放心地使用其产品。

总结

TokenIM 2.0 作为一款功能全面的即时通讯工具,凭借其开源特性、快速稳定性以及强大的安全保障,成为了非常不错的选择。通过完整的源码下载及安装配置,开发者就可以根据自身的需求进行二次开发,定制属于自己的通讯解决方案。

本文详细介绍了 TokenIM 2.0 的源码下载、安装、配置、使用以及常见问题的解答,希望能帮助用户更好地理解和使用这一工具。在未来的使用中,用户可以根据实际需求进行调整和扩展,不断探索其更深层次的使用乐趣和潜力。